Greg has terrible study habits: whenever he is given an assignment to be done either in class or at home, he does not begin the assignment until he has been repeatedly nagged by either you (his teacher) or by his parents.Furthermore, Greg seems unable to complete assignments without constant prodding to stay on task.Explain how you might use operant conditioning to help Greg develop better study habits.Be concrete and specific in your explanation of what you would do, and be sure to include:
a.the baseline;
b.the terminal behaviour;
c.a secondary reinforcer you might use;
d.shaping; and,
e.some means of preventing extinction.
